Home > No Such > No Such File Or Directory Error In Perl

No Such File Or Directory Error In Perl

Contents

We failed but then still tried to print() something to it. Why not use read? –ThisSuitIsBlackNot Dec 19 '13 at 23:16 @ThisSuitIsBlackNot: Printing the first 100 characters is a sample task for the purpose of explaining the issue I'm having. and .. Sending HTML e-mail using Email::Stuffer Perl/CGI script with Apache2 JSON in Perl Simple Database access using Perl DBI and SQL Reading from LDAP in Perl using Net::LDAP Common warnings and error http://themedemo.net/no-such/no-such-file-or-directory-perl-error.html

open(my $fh, '>', 'correct_directory_with_typo/report.txt') or die "Could not open file 'some_strange_name/report.txt'"; ...but you will still get the old error message because they changed it only in the open() call, and not To do that you need to tell Perl, you are opening the file with UTF-8 encoding. Why are roles handed off differently in the Epilogue? If the open() is successful then it returns TRUE and thus the right part never gets executed. http://stackoverflow.com/questions/28954298/perl-error-no-such-file-or-directory

Perl Opendir No Such File Or Directory

all over the place. open my $in_fh1, '<', $infile1 or die qq{Failed to open "$infile1" for writing: $!}; open my $out_fh1, '>', $outfile1 or die qq{Failed to open "$outfile1" for writing: $!}; Your problem is When I loaded up the page in my web browser, I immediately got this error: Internal Server Error The server encountered an internal error or misconfiguration and was unable to complete my $in_fh1 = $infile1->openr; my $out_fh1 = $outfile1->openw; # Process just the Frequencies line.

I have manually downloaded the I-... open close write die open or die > encoding UTF-8 Prev Next Lots of Perl programs deal with text files such as configuration files or log files, so in order to This allows us to keep the site focused on the topics that the community can help with. Perl File Open How long could the sun be turned off without overly damaging planet Earth + humanity?

My true task does involve the entire document and isn't relevant to the open issue. (The error occurs when trying to open the document, before trying to use it for anything.) Perl on the command line Core Perl documentation and CPAN module documentation POD - Plain Old Documentation Debugging Perl scripts Scalars Common Warnings and Error messages in Perl Automatic string to Issue in Admin Panel after SUPEE Patch 8788 installation Thesis reviewer requests update to literature review to incorporate last four years of research. More likely than not you will see it is an invalid filename (such as containing a linefeed or other illegal character).PS1: I also changed your open to the three arguments variant.

Word for "to direct attention away from" How do I depower overpowered magic items without breaking immersion? Perl Write To File perl share|improve this question edited Dec 20 '13 at 16:48 asked Dec 19 '13 at 22:49 Alex A. 3,82831136 Beware of hidden whitespace: use chomp –ThisSuitIsBlackNot Dec 19 '13 Faq Reply With Quote November 27th, 2012,11:00 AM #4 No Profile Picture testerV View Profile View Forum Posts  Contributing User Devshed Newbie (0 - 499 posts)  Join Date It is more complex than using opendir, though, so you should use opendir unless you need to dive into subdirectories.

  1. It also will throw errors on failure, so you don't need to write or die on everything.
  2. It looks almost the same as the print() in other parts of the tutorial, but now the first parameter is the file-handle and there is no(!) comma after it.
  3. It could be something like "No such file or directory" or "Permission denied".
  4. What's wrong?
  5. Writing to files with Perl Appending to files Open and read from text files Don't Open Files in the old way slurp mode - reading a file in one step Lists
  6. Password Home Search Forums Register Forum RulesMan PagesUnix Commands Linux Commands FAQ Members Today's Posts Homework & Coursework Questions Students must use and complete the template provided.
  7. In this case, this is the the greater-than sign (>) that means we are opening the file for writing.

Can't Open Perl Script No Such File Or Directory

instead of the real subdirectories. Keep it simple 2. Perl Opendir No Such File Or Directory Try commenting out the use warnings and see the script is now silent when it fails to create the file. No Such File Or Directory Perl Does Wolverine's healing factor still work properly in Logan (the movie)?

Any help wou... his comment is here ImportError: No module named pymol (Mac) Hi,   Being new to python scripting, I am facing a simple problem. Indenting properly is never a waste of time. I am wondering how can I do upper case the first letter of "Frequencies" word in the part my $search_text1 = qr/Frequencies/;? –perlselami Mar 10 '15 at 3:33 @perlselami Perl Bad Interpreter No Such File Or Directory

The attempts at a solution (include all code and scripts): I tried all of those recommendations: I remove any whitespace, I put in a check for any nonprintable characters, I hard-coded Then the right side of the or is also executed. The second parameter defines the way we are opening the file. http://themedemo.net/no-such/no-such-file-or-directory-error-2.html No longer do you need to load one module to make a directory and another to find out what directory you're in and another to manipulate paths and another to...

USB in computer screen not working Take a ride on the Reading, If you pass Go, collect $200 Can I stop this homebrewed Lucky Coin ability from being exploited? What is the difference (if any) between "not true" and "false"? How to find positive things in a code review?

What are the legal and ethical implications of "padding" pay with extra hours to compensate for unpaid work?

about • faq • rss Community Log In Sign Up Add New Post Question: (Closed) Job not running: 'No such file or directory' but the script exists 0 2.2 years ago The open function gets 3 parameters. That greater-than sign in the open call might be a bit unclear, but if you are familiar with command line redirection then this can be familiar to you too. die is a function call that will throw an exception and thus exit our script. "open or die" is a logical expression.

node historyNode Type: perlquestion [id://988946]Approved by Ratazonghelp Chatterbox? and the pool shimmers... ken6503 Shell Programming and Scripting 7 05-07-2013 05:05 PM How to check if a file exists in a directory? Presumably not. navigate here masses -- 6.7793 1.0546 5.5674 Frc consts -- 0.0022 0.0010 0.0106 IR Inten -- 2.4504 0.2236 0.6152 Atom AN X Y Z X Y Z X Y Z 1 6 0.00

Non-latin character? I made a couple edits to get it to work properly. Briefly, when I launch a script with the 'qsub' command (from the master node ) the job does not work and I find the following error message in the 'log' file: What would I call a "do not buy from" list?

With this we got back to the original example. Tomorrow I'll try to fix it, then approve your answer / comment again. –albifant Mar 16 '12 at 16:17 @albifant The standard version of Perl is in /usr/bin. –egreg Do I need to do this? Dec 20 '13 at 17:47 @TLP: thanks; good point.